Bug#665041: ITP: etl -- Synfig extended template library



Package: wnpp
Severity: wishlist
Owner: Denis Washington <denisw@online.de>

* Package name    : etl
  Version         : 0.4.4
  Upstream Author : Synfig Studio Development Team
* URL             : http://www.synfig.org/
* License         : GPL
  Programming Lang: C++
  Description     : Synfig extended template library

ETL is a multi-platform class and template library designed to add new
datatypes and functions which combine well with the existing types and
functions from the C++ Standard Template Library (STL). It is developed and
used by the Synfig Studio development team.

etl already was in Debian, but was removed together with synfig from the
package archives (bug #612070). Dmitry Smirnov <onlyjob at fsf member org> has
recently updated the etl, synfig and synfigstudio packages to the latest
upstream and standards versions, and he and I would be willing to maintain the
package in the future. Upstream is active (the latest upstream version was
released in February 2012). The GCC 4.5 FTBFS mentioned in the mentioned bug
report is fixed. Both of us tested the packages on Debian unstable and have not
found any problems yet.
